DATA Restore

 کبھی بھی پرانا ڈیٹا بیس نئے کوہا ورژن پر ریسٹور نہ کریں۔

OPEN Terminal

sudo su

Password: ****

…. mysql -uroot -p

Password *****

mysql> drop database koha_library;

اوپر والی کمانڈ سے کوہا ڈیٹابیس کے نام سے بنایا گیا ڈیٹابیس ختم ہو جاتا ہے۔ اس لئے اس کمانڈ کو استعمال کرتے وقت یاد رکھیں کہ اگر پرانا ڈیٹا بیس ختم کر کے نیا ڈیٹا بیس بنانا ہو تو اس کو استعمال کریں ۔ اور اس کمانڈ کو استعمال کرنے سے پہلے ڈیٹا کا بیک اپ ضرور لے لیں۔

CREATE NEW DATABASE FOR OLD BACKUP

 نیچے والی کمانڈ میں پرانے ڈیٹا بیس کا نام بتانا ہے۔ نیچے والی کمانڈ سے نیا ڈیٹا بیس بنا جائے گا۔۔۔ اس کمانڈ کی اس وقت ضرورت ہے جب اوپر والی کمانڈ سے پرانا ڈیٹابیس ختم کر دیا جائے اور نیا بنا دیا جائے۔

mysql> create database koha_library;

mysql> quit;

Bye

to restore old database into new database

نیچے والی کمانڈ سے پہلے کوہا لائبریری ایس کیو ایل (بیک اپ) والی فائل کو ہوم والے فولڈر میں رکھ دیں۔

اس کمانڈ کو چلانے سے پرانا (سب کچھ، ڈیٹا، ولیوز وغیرہ) واپس (ریسٹور) ہو جاتا ہے۔

IN NEW TERMINAL

sudo su

password: ****

…..# mysql -uroot -p koha_library < koha_library.sql         (.sql must mention with extracted/unzip backup_file name)

Enter Password: *****

اس میں کچھ وقت لگے گا

#### exit

Exit

 

ڈیٹا ریسٹور کرنے کے بعد نیچے والی کمانڈ ضرور چلائیں۔ ڈیٹا ریسٹور کرتے وقت اگر کوئی چھوٹے موٹے مسلے ہوں تو نیچے والی کمانڈ سے حل ہو جاتے ہیں۔

sudo su

Password:

#... sudo service memcached restart

#... sudo koha-upgrade-schema library (no need of this command if KOHA already installed)

sudo koha-rebuild-zebra -v -f library

OR

koha-rebuild-zebra -f -a -b -v library


No comments:

Post a Comment

Total Pageviews